Internet based schools and programs are often different from those offered at traditional colleges and universities. The most notable and primary difference being the setting in which an individual learns. For, it is easier for some students to learn in a classroom environment in which there are daily assignments and projects. Whereas, online courses and programs can be extremely beneficial to individuals whom are housebound due to the health reasons, or for those whom need flexibility with regards to course selection, watching lectures and completing assignments.

In fact, one of the main reasons individuals choose to study online is the flexible schedules and ability to watch classes and lectures any time day or night. In addition, students are often given longer to complete assignments when studying online. Although, depending on the program, students may still need to do some work and attend testing sessions on-campus even when completing an online program.

While there are a lot of positive aspects when it comes to internet based study, there are also a few drawbacks. One of the biggest is that courses completed through an internet based program may not transfer to a university program at a later date. In addition, individuals completing online programs need to have a strong sense of self discipline in order to watch lectures, complete assignments and pass tests as indicated in the course syllabus.
